KS14 MKA is a 2014 Suzuki SX4 in Blue with a 1,598c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2014 Suzuki SX4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.3% with a typical mileage of 48,873 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ki SX4 f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 10,592 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KS14 MKA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ki SX4 typ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 12 years old, this Suzuki SX4 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
